Answer:

The weight would be 18.3 pounds and the mass would be 11.2 kilograms

Step-by-step explanation:

The weight of an object is the force of gravity on the object and is given by the mass times the gravity:

Weight = mass x gravity

If the gravity on the moon is 1/6 the gravitational force on earth, then the weight of an object on the moon will be 1/6 of its weight on earth:

Weight on moon = mass x 1/6 gravity on earth = 1/6 weight on earth

Weight on moon = 1/6 (110 pounds) = 18.3 pounds

On the other hand, the mass of an object is a fundamental property and represents the amount of matter in the object, so it doesn’t variate. Then, the mass on the moon and on earth will be 11.2 kilograms
